Science in Short Chapters by W. Mattieu Williams (1820 - 1892).

This project is now complete! All audio files can be found on our catalog page: https://librivox.org/science-in-short-chapters-by-w-mattieu-williams/
This is a collection of articles written by W. Mattieu Williams on different subjects, that in his opinion "are likely to be interesting to all readers who are sufficiently intelligent to prefer sober fact to sensational fiction, but who, at the same time, do not profess to be scientific specialists." This book offers and intriguing glimpse into the scientific ideas of late 19th century. Though nowadays these essays should not be seen as wholly scientifically accurate, they are still entertaining and in many basic aspects remain truthful. ( Kikisaulite)
